Videos on climate change by Finnish and Japanese youth to be presented at COP26

When the cities of Nagano and Obuse in Japan and Turku in Finland were paired up for cooperation within the IUC programme in 2019, they were interested in tackling the issue of climate change. Makassar: Addressing Energy and Climate Change Issues

Capacity building for development of Climate Action Plan Makassar, the capital of Sulawesi Province in Indonesia, began its cooperation on energy and climate change within the Global Covenant of Mayors for Climate & Energy (GCoM) programme in July 2019 when the European Union made a roadshow to the city.
